    I actually do have something along the lines of the original intent of this message. My stepson wants a desktop computer because his notebook is always in use by someone in the family, and I have told him you get more for your money with a desktop. That being said, he naturally wants to throw together a gaming rig. Well, as you and I both know, those can get pricey. Now here's the deal... I have been trying to figure out what we could throw together a rig that would have been top of the line say 2-3 yrs ago for. Every time I try starting from a barebones, I end up hitting $600 before I'm done. The damned OS costing $109 doesn't help, and I do not want to teach him piracy as I think programmers deserve their living. Lord knows, it's a tedious job and I'd rather they do it than me. I have also explored the off-lease option, but most times then you are talking about a low power supply so dropping a decent vid card in there wouldn't work. I like Linux for the OS, but naturally he's windows only because he has 0 experience with anything else and game emulation on Linux leave a lot to be desired anyway.

    I'm thinking along the lines of 1-1.5 TB hard drive, at least 2 G RAM, decent vid card that has HD out, built in sound (I'd even do vid on the MB if it was a fair rig. At least a 400W PS. Have a wireless keyboard and mouse, don't need floppy. DVD +RW a must.

    Suggestions? I'd like to buy it as parts so I can teach him how to build one. I have spent a lot of time on tigerdirect where I do a lot of business. I need the system to handle windows 7 and be able to at least run most modern games at a playable level if not at an astounding frame rate.
